Alrighty, yes. This game did come out, but unfortunately it’s content release cycle was cut short with plenty of things that were finished left to be unreleased. This happened due to a Lawsuit between Victor Miller and Horror Inc where after a specific deadline nothing F13 Related couldn’t be released since it would be considered new. Victor Miller has been trying to get the rights to the original films scripts for awhile now since originally he sold it to Sean S Cunningham a long time ago.
The cancellation of all this content left me burned solely because the developers decided to push out a Unreal Engine 4 Update instead of actual content as one of the last updates.
Here is a list of Official Content left unreleased.
Collectible Photos
Various Emotes
Updated Counselor Clothing Packs for DLC Counselors.
Slumber Party Clothing Pack
Space Clothing Pack
Weapons (Sledge Hammer, PT.8 Electric Guitar, Retro Axe)
Various Jason Kill Packs ( Savini Jason, Part 9, Part 8, Part 6, Part 5, Part 3)
Retro Jason being implemented. (Was released as a PT.3 skin, but was planned to be a independent Jason)
Uber Jason (Jason X)
Kay-Em Hunter (meant a to replace Tommy Jarvis for Grendal)
Grendal (Jason X Space Map)
Lazarus Experience (Virtual Cabin 3 meant to reveal the Manhattan Map)
Manhattan Map (PT 8)
Sandbox Mode
LAN Support
Paranoia Game Mode
As you can see a lot of content was planned, but was never released.
